Home
last modified time | relevance | path

Searched refs:dr_mode (Results 1 – 25 of 222) sorted by relevance

123456789

/openbmc/u-boot/drivers/usb/common/
H A Dcommon.c26 const char *dr_mode; in usb_get_dr_mode() local
29 dr_mode = fdt_getprop(fdt, node, "dr_mode", NULL); in usb_get_dr_mode()
30 if (!dr_mode) { in usb_get_dr_mode()
36 if (!strcmp(dr_mode, usb_dr_modes[i])) in usb_get_dr_mode()
/openbmc/u-boot/drivers/usb/host/
H A Dxhci-dwc3.c119 enum usb_dr_mode dr_mode; in xhci_dwc3_probe() local
135 dr_mode = usb_get_dr_mode(dev_of_offset(dev)); in xhci_dwc3_probe()
136 if (dr_mode == USB_DR_MODE_UNKNOWN) in xhci_dwc3_probe()
138 dr_mode = USB_DR_MODE_HOST; in xhci_dwc3_probe()
140 dwc3_set_mode(dwc3_reg, dr_mode); in xhci_dwc3_probe()
H A Dehci-vf.c200 enum dr_mode { enum
212 enum dr_mode dr_mode; member
229 priv->dr_mode = DR_MODE_HOST; in vf_usb_ofdata_to_platdata()
232 priv->dr_mode = DR_MODE_DEVICE; in vf_usb_ofdata_to_platdata()
235 priv->dr_mode = DR_MODE_OTG; in vf_usb_ofdata_to_platdata()
249 priv->dr_mode = DR_MODE_HOST; in vf_usb_ofdata_to_platdata()
253 if (priv->dr_mode == DR_MODE_OTG) { in vf_usb_ofdata_to_platdata()
H A Dehci-tegra.c52 enum dr_mode { enum
78 enum dr_mode dr_mode; /* dual role mode */ member
262 config->dr_mode == DR_MODE_OTG && in set_up_vbus()
374 if (config->dr_mode == DR_MODE_OTG && in init_utmi_usb_controller()
701 config->dr_mode = DR_MODE_HOST; in fdt_decode_usb()
703 config->dr_mode = DR_MODE_DEVICE; in fdt_decode_usb()
705 config->dr_mode = DR_MODE_OTG; in fdt_decode_usb()
712 config->dr_mode = DR_MODE_HOST; in fdt_decode_usb()
731 gpio_get_number(&config->phy_reset_gpio), config->dr_mode, in fdt_decode_usb()
743 switch (config->dr_mode) { in usb_common_init()
[all …]
/openbmc/u-boot/doc/
H A DREADME.fsl-hwconfig40 'dr_mode'
44 usb1:dr_mode=host;usb2:dr_mode=peripheral'
46 usb1:dr_mode=host,phy_type=utmi;usb2:dr_mode=host'
/openbmc/u-boot/drivers/usb/dwc3/
H A Ddwc3-generic.c92 dwc3->dr_mode = usb_get_dr_mode(node); in dwc3_generic_peripheral_ofdata_to_platdata()
93 if (dwc3->dr_mode == USB_DR_MODE_UNKNOWN) { in dwc3_generic_peripheral_ofdata_to_platdata()
215 enum usb_dr_mode dr_mode; in dwc3_glue_bind() local
221 dr_mode = usb_get_dr_mode(node); in dwc3_glue_bind()
223 switch (dr_mode) { in dwc3_glue_bind()
320 enum usb_dr_mode dr_mode; in dwc3_glue_probe() local
322 dr_mode = usb_get_dr_mode(dev_of_offset(child)); in dwc3_glue_probe()
325 ops->select_dr_mode(dev, index, dr_mode); in dwc3_glue_probe()
H A Dcore.c464 if ((dwc->dr_mode == USB_DR_MODE_HOST || in dwc3_core_init()
465 dwc->dr_mode == USB_DR_MODE_OTG) && in dwc3_core_init()
545 switch (dwc->dr_mode) { in dwc3_core_init_mode()
577 dev_err(dev, "Unsupported mode of operation %d\n", dwc->dr_mode); in dwc3_core_init_mode()
586 switch (dwc->dr_mode) { in dwc3_core_exit_mode()
660 dwc->dr_mode = dwc3_dev->dr_mode; in dwc3_uboot_init()
698 dwc->dr_mode = USB_DR_MODE_HOST; in dwc3_uboot_init()
700 dwc->dr_mode = USB_DR_MODE_PERIPHERAL; in dwc3_uboot_init()
702 if (dwc->dr_mode == USB_DR_MODE_UNKNOWN) in dwc3_uboot_init()
703 dwc->dr_mode = USB_DR_MODE_OTG; in dwc3_uboot_init()
/openbmc/u-boot/arch/arm/dts/
H A Dvf-colibri.dtsi24 dr_mode = "otg";
30 dr_mode = "host";
H A Dbcm283x-rpi-usb-host.dtsi2 dr_mode = "host";
H A Dimx6ul-phycore-segin.dts45 dr_mode = "otg";
53 dr_mode = "host";
H A Dam335x-evm-u-boot.dtsi12 dr_mode = "peripheral";
H A Dzynq-cc108.dts108 dr_mode = "host";
114 dr_mode = "host";
H A Dkeystone-k2g-evm.dts46 dr_mode = "host";
60 dr_mode = "peripheral";
H A Dtegra210-e2220-1170.dts44 dr_mode = "peripheral";
H A Dtegra210-p2371-0000.dts44 dr_mode = "otg";
H A Dzynq-zc770-xm011-x16.dts63 dr_mode = "host";
H A Dzynq-zc770-xm011.dts63 dr_mode = "host";
H A Dzynq-microzed.dts67 dr_mode = "host";
H A Dzynq-zybo.dts69 dr_mode = "host";
/openbmc/u-boot/doc/device-tree-bindings/usb/
H A Ddwc3-st.txt31 NB: The dr_mode property is NOT optional for this driver, as the default value
32 is "otg", which isn't supported by this SoC. Valid dr_mode values for dwc3-st are
56 dr_mode = "host";
/openbmc/u-boot/board/ti/omap5_uevm/
H A Devm.c91 usb_otg_ss.dr_mode = USB_DR_MODE_PERIPHERAL; in board_usb_init()
94 usb_otg_ss.dr_mode = USB_DR_MODE_HOST; in board_usb_init()
/openbmc/u-boot/drivers/usb/musb-new/
H A Dti-musb.c295 enum usb_dr_mode dr_mode; in ti_musb_wrapper_bind() local
301 dr_mode = usb_get_dr_mode(node); in ti_musb_wrapper_bind()
302 switch (dr_mode) { in ti_musb_wrapper_bind()
/openbmc/u-boot/board/st/stih410-b2260/
H A Dboard.c45 .dr_mode = USB_DR_MODE_PERIPHERAL,
/openbmc/u-boot/include/
H A Ddwc3-uboot.h16 enum usb_dr_mode dr_mode; member
/openbmc/u-boot/board/intel/edison/
H A Dedison.c22 .dr_mode = USB_DR_MODE_PERIPHERAL,

123456789